    Default SSL encryption is required for access to this server, when AWBS connect to cPanel

    Hi,

    Currently i upgrade cPanel to latest stable version 11.28 from 11.25. "Require SSL" option enabled in previous version and it was working fine with my billing system - AWBS (Advance Webhost Billing System).

    when cPanel upgraded to latest version, the billing system cannot connect to cPanel Server and prompted "SSL encryption is required for access to this server" when it trying to connect , suspend/unsuspend an account.

    May i know is there any changes in latest version to cause this issue? or any solution for this?

    Default Re: SSL encryption is required for access to this server, when AWBS connect to cPanel

    Hello

    To confirm, is the following option enabled under the "Security" tab in "WHM >> Server Configuration >> Tweak Settings":

    "Require SSL"

    If it is enabled, do you experience the same problem when this option is disabled?

    To note, I do suggest contacting the support team for this third-party application to determine if any updates or resolutions are available.
